Comprehending Bay Windows

Bay windows are typically made up of 3 areas: a big main window flanked by two smaller sized windows, either angled or curved outward from the wall. This design transforms a basic flat wall into an inviting nook, ideal for developing seating locations, plants, or decorative screens.

Design Selection
Pick the design and kind of bay window that fits the home's aesthetic appeals. Alternatives consist of:

  • Box Bay Windows: Simple, with a flat front.
  • Canted Bay Windows: Typically form a hexagonal shape.
  • Curved Bay Windows: Feature a softer, rounded look.

Installation Process Overview

The installation process can vary depending upon the kind of bay window and existing structures. However, there's a basic series of steps that most specialists will follow, including:

  1. Removing Existing Windows: The very first step in the installation is to thoroughly eliminate any existing window or structure in the installation area.
  2. Framing: New framing is built to accommodate the bay window, making sure structural integrity and compliance with construction requirements.
  3. Window Installation: The bay windows are set up according to manufacturer requirements, ensuring they are plumb, level, and firmly attached.
  4. Sealing and Insulation: Proper sealing and insulation are integral for energy effectiveness and avoiding water seepage.
  5. Completing Touches: After installation, exterior and interior surfaces are applied. This may involve trim work, painting, or any additional decor.

Upkeep Tips for Bay Windows

After the installation of bay windows, property owners must be proactive in their maintenance to ensure durability and efficiency. Here are some maintenance suggestions:

  • Regular Cleaning: Keep the glass clean to allow optimal light penetration and maintain views.
  • Check for Drafts: Periodically examine seals and weather condition removing for indications of wear or leaks and replace them as required.
  • Check Frames: Look for signs of rot, particularly in wooden frames, and deal with any issues without delay.
  • Set Up Professional Inspections: Consider having professional inspections to evaluate the integrity of the installation regularly.
